Note for maintainers: the Quillstone FX feed rounds converted amounts to four decimal places before we apply our own two-place rounding, which occasionally causes one-cent discrepancies in reconciliation. Do not patch this locally; the vendor has acknowledged the behavior and a feed change is planned. Questions about the remediation timeline go to the address below.

escalation mailbox, bafog-fafog: ulador@paliqlabs.internal

## Releases

Coinharbor rounds all conversions with banker's rounding at the minor-unit boundary. Release builds include the rounding test vectors in `fixtures/rounding/`; do not ship if any vector drifts. Tag releases as `vX.Y.Z`, run `make dist`, and let CI sign the tarball. Contractors cannot trigger releases directly — open a release PR and a maintainer approves. Verify any downloaded artifact before use. Artifacts are verified against the key below.

release key, hadug-kawef: bky13_mPGeFZeR1GZ1G

## Broker upgrade — Quillhaven cluster

1. Drain consumers; confirm lag is zero.
2. Snapshot the metadata volume.
3. Roll nodes one at a time, oldest first.
4. Verify replication catches up before the next node.
5. Re-enable producers.

If anything fails, abort and restore the snapshot. Record the upgrade against the build token below.

pipeline stamp: htk4_c337

Franchise Agreement — Managers Only

Applies to all Kettlewick Coffeeworks branches. Standard term: five years, renewable once. Royalty: 6% of gross, payable monthly. Branding, fit-out, and menu changes require head-office sign-off. Territory exclusivity covers a two-kilometre radius. Breach of supply-chain terms triggers a 30-day cure period. Renewal talks for the Dornely cluster begin next quarter. Do not share externally. Confidential planning note follows below.

management briefing: Project Ulavan slips by two quarters because of the staffing delay.

## Onboarding: Fareweight Rules Engine

Fareweight computes shipping fees from stacked rule sets. Rules are versioned; never edit a live version. Deploys go through the staging evaluator first. Read the rule DSL guide before touching anything.

Rule definitions live in the pricing database — connect to it with the connection string below.

primary connection of yagep-bajop = postgresql://druiel_svc:gW@db-3860.sivrelworks.example:5432/brieth